The annual general meeting of the Agrl. cultural and Pastoral Association will be held on Friday (to-day), at the New Zealand Loan and Mercantile offices, Featherston street. The report and balance sheet for tho past year is being prepared, and shows gratifying results in some points. The entries received tor the last Show were 152 above the number of the former year. The sales after the Show proved very satis, faotory, many of the animals being quitted at prices far above the reserve. The Association’s first Ram and Ewe Fair proved very successful, and the Southern breeders who exhibited were so satisfied with the result that they have promised to accord the Association much larger support at their next Fair.
